With its 420-horsepower twin-turbocharged inline-six and multiple four-wheel drive systems, the Wagoneer can easily handle heavy loads and off-road trails with ease. And with a spacious three-row interior and class-leading towing capacity, it can comfortably accommodate a family plus plenty of gear.
The 2025 Wagoneer is well-appointed inside, with a wide variety of premium options and features. Leather upholstery is standard, and you can opt for a capri or nappa trim that adds a touch of luxury. You can also enjoy real wood accents in the cabin, and in the top Series III models, a McIntosh 19-speaker premium audio system is available that’s among the best we’ve ever tested.

We love the dark aesthetic in the Carbide trim, which adds black wheels and interior accents to give the Wagoneer a refined yet rugged look. It’s an option that can help you accentuate the SUV’s powerful presence on the road, and it pairs well with the Quadra-Lift air suspension, which elevates ground clearance to improve off-road capability.
The Wagoneer is one of the most capable full-size SUVs on the market, and it’s not too hard on your wallet either. It achieves a competitive 17 mpg combined fuel economy rating, and it can tow up to 10,000 pounds. Its hefty size can make it ponderous to drive in town, but the refined suspension of the Carbide and Grand Wagoneers improves things a bit.
